FUGITT v. JONES

No. 76-2488.

549 F.2d 1001 (1977)

Patricia A. FUGITT (Patricia Craig Stewart), Plaintiff-Appellant, v. Clarence JONES, Sheriff, Dallas County, Texas, et al., Defendants-Appellees.

United States Court of Appeals, Fifth Circuit.

April 1, 1977.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

Robert L. Yeager, III, Dallas, Tex., (Court-appointed), for plaintiff-appellant.

Henry Wade, Dist. Atty., John B. Tolle, Asst. Dist. Atty., Dallas, Tex., for defendants-appellees.

Before TUTTLE, GOLDBERG and CLARK, Circuit Judges.


CLARK, Circuit Judge:

Patricia Fugitt originally brought this suit as a class action under Section 1 of the Civil Rights Act of 1871, 42 U.S.C.A. § 1983 (1974).1 She withdrew all of her class action claims and her request for injunctive relief at the pre-trial conference and now seeks only damages.
